Veranda Sealing in Bellevue, WA
Veranda sealing services involve applying protective coatings to outdoor porch and patio structures to help preserve their appearance and durability. This process is suitable for a variety of projects, including sealing wooden, composite, or concrete verandas, decks, and pergolas. Proper sealing helps prevent damage caused by moisture, UV rays, and everyday wear, extending the lifespan of the outdoor space while maintaining its aesthetic appeal. Homeowners typically request this service to safeguard their investment and keep their outdoor living areas looking well-maintained and inviting.
Before requesting veranda sealing, property owners should consider the current condition of their outdoor structures, including any existing damage or signs of wear that may need attention beforehand. It’s also useful to understand the types of sealants used, their compatibility with the materials involved, and the recommended maintenance schedule to ensure long-lasting results. Clear communication about project scope and material preferences can help ensure the sealing process meets expectations and provides the desired level of protection.

Veranda Sealing Questions
What is veranda sealing? Veranda sealing involves applying a protective coating to the surface to prevent damage from moisture, UV rays, and daily wear.
Why should homeowners consider veranda sealing? Sealing helps preserve the appearance and integrity of the veranda, extending its lifespan and reducing maintenance needs.
What types of verandas benefit from sealing? Wooden, composite, and concrete verandas all benefit from sealing to protect against weather and environmental elements.
When is the best time to seal a veranda? Sealing is most effective during dry, mild weather conditions, typically in spring or early summer.
